Transaction 3e45f4c15a0f7ad876bb26fb11a83fbd8edf7004d963044cf5c0f276fcb033ec

47 Input
1 Outputs
  • 3e45f4c15a0f7ad876bb26fb11a83fbd8edf7004d963044cf5c0f276fcb033ec:0
  • value  233104420
    address  12m8zmVgZpH8ekcPbNKAnDhwxfEaJqBumj